Tampa Bay Polyaspartic Floor Coatings

About twenty years ago polyaspartic coatings were made to prevent corrosion in steel. It was successful enough to be developed into a concrete coating and since then has been used in many Tampa Bay area homes and businesses. The basic components are much like epoxy and are applied to the top of the concrete. Additions of color and chips and quartz can be added to the coating while it is wet. A top coating will keep the quartz and the chips in place and the result is very decorative.

Qualities of Polyaspartic Coatings

A simple explanation is that polyaspartic coatings are those that protect the garage floor. When polyaspartic esters are added to the concrete it cures faster. If less polyaspartic esters are used then the time for the concrete to cure is slower. If professionally applied, the result is a very functional concrete floor. Most polyaspartic floors are ready within one day for use where as epoxy flooring can take as long as three days to cure. This makes polyaspartic a much more desirable choice for both convenience and durability. Polyaspartic coatings can adjust to all kinds of weather from extreme cold to extreme heat.

Stopping Ground Moisture

Frequently in the Tampa Bay area, there is moisture in the ground. The garage will also have ground moisture, and coupled with inclement weather such as heavy rains, the moisture is trapped in the ground. Moisture can seep under the slab floor and push up through the air holes in the concrete. Polyaspartic coatings help prevent damage from moisture because they are absorbed by the concrete rather than just lay on the top. If a professional applies the polyaspartic coating using grinding equipment, then the coatings penetrate the concrete and are absorbed into the surface. When the concrete is cured then the coatings are a part of the floor and bar any moisture from damaging the concrete.

Fixing a Damaged Concrete Floor

When there is moisture beneath a concrete floor there is salt that pushes its way to the top and damages the concrete. The damaged concrete floor can be fixed with the use of polyaspartic coatings because polyaspartic coatings have great wetting and penetrating characteristics that make it a part of the floor. If it is humid it does not restrict the application of polyaspartic coatings but some will set faster in high humidity.

Properties of Polyaspartic Floor Coatings

Polyaspartic coatings have certain properties that make them better than most epoxy coatings, such as:

  • They can be installed all year long in temperatures of up to one hundred and forty degrees;
  • They have clear finishes and are resistant to UV rays;
  • They are more impact resistant than epoxy or urethane;
  • They don't lose they color;
  • Curing is fast as polyaspartic coating can cure in one day as opposed to three days with epoxy or urethane coatings.
  • Your garage floor will be protected from and mild acids, fats or oils and polyaspartic coatings do not stain.

Making The Floor Non-Slip

Many professionals will add a non-slip particle into each layer of the concrete to make the floor less conducive to slipping. They use the right size non-slip particles in each layer thus keeping friction manageable. If the coating is too thick to put non-slip particles into each layer, then they are placed into the top only. Placing non-slip particles on the top is not practical since they wear down quickly and the floor becomes slippery.
